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Heighington to Bulwell start from as little as £15.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Heighington to Bulwell start from £100.40 one way, or £101.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Heighington to Bulwell are available for £103.40 one way, or £169.90 return

Everything you need to know about Heighington Station

Discover Heighington Train Station

Heighington Train Station, located in County Durham, England, serves as a quaint but essential hub for both locals and visitors seeking to explore the North East of England. Although it offers basic facilities, its strategic position makes it a convenient spot for those traveling by rail. Let’s take a closer look at what you can expect when visiting Heighington Station.

Facilities and Services

Though lacking a traditional ticket office, Heighington Station allows passengers to purchase and collect tickets via accessible machines situated on Platform 1. For those with visual or auditory impairments, an induction loop is available. While there aren't amenities like cafes, shops, or waiting rooms, the station is equipped with customer help points and helpful information screens to keep you updated on departure times. For any assistance required, travelers can rest easy knowing there’s a helpline available at 08002006060.

Accessibility at Heighington

Heighington Station is categorized as a Category B station, meaning that step-free access is possible in some regions of the station. There is level access to the platforms via a level crossing, ensuring that individuals with mobility impairments or those using wheelchairs can navigate with relative ease. However, there are no accessible toilets or waiting room facilities, so it's wise to plan accordingly.

Onward Travel Options

Should your journey take you further afield, rest assured that Heighington provides several onward travel options. There is a bus stop conveniently located near the station, serviced by Busline at 0871 200 2233. For those seeking a more direct route, taxi services can be arranged through Northern Rail's Cab4You service. During periods of rail replacement, passengers will find the pick-up/drop-off point at the lay-by near the level crossing.

Everything you need to know about Bulwell Station

Welcome to Bulwell Train Station

Nestled in the vibrant town of Bulwell, Nottinghamshire, Bulwell Train Station serves as a gateway to both local adventures and further afield destinations. Whether you're a regular commuter or a first-time visitor eager to discover what this charming locale has to offer, Bulwell Station is well-equipped to meet your travel needs. From convenient ticketing options to accessible transport links, Bulwell is a hub of connectivity and efficiency.

Facilities and Amenities

The station offers essential facilities to ensure your journey is as smooth and hassle-free as possible. While there is no traditional ticket office, rest assured that you can purchase and collect tickets using the automated machines available—these machines are also fully accessible for passengers with mobility impairments. In addition to ticket dispensers, Bulwell provides smartcard validators and an induction loop, accommodating a range of passenger needs.

For those needing assistance, staff help is accessible through help points, and there is CCTV throughout for added security. There are no dedicated waiting rooms or seating areas, nor are there refreshment facilities or shops, so plan accordingly. Although the station lacks some amenities such as toilets and baby-changing facilities, it compensates with its core services and reassuring presence of help points.

Accessibility and Support

Accessibility is a priority at Bulwell Station with partial step-free access available on some platforms. However, it's recommended to inquire ahead of your visit to ensure your specific needs are met. Passenger Assist services can be pre-booked up to two hours before travel, which is a thoughtful touch for those who might require some extra time and assistance during their journey. Unfortunately, there is no provision for accessible taxis or designated mobility set-down points, so alternative arrangements might be necessary for those in need of these services.

Onward Travel

Bulwell Station is not just your starting point; it’s a bridge to many more destinations. The station provides efficient transport links including local bus services from the bus stops on Main Street, which can replace rail services whenever necessary. To plan your journey further, you can print useful information here. However, do keep in mind that there is no provision for cycle hire, but bike storage is available for those who prefer to use them as part of their travel.
